Model answer (5 marks)

Mitosis produces two daughter cells that contain identical copies of DNA to the parent cell, allowing the organism to grow and replace old or damaged cells.
Cell differentiation produces specialised cells adapted to carry out a specific function, achieved by altering genes in the cell's DNA, leading to greater efficiency.

Common mistakes

  • Confusing mitosis with meiosis or omitting that daughter cells are genetically identical.
  • Using vague phrases like "cell growth" without linking to mitosis.
  • Failing to mention that differentiation involves gene alteration for specialised function.
